In 2023, the sugar-energy sector supplied nearly 21,000 GWh of electricity to the national distribution grid,
making it the third largest source of electricity for the Brazilian population.

The electricity generated by sugar-energy plants is equivalent to the consumption of nearly 11 million Brazilian households.

The energy generated by sugar-energy plants prevented the emission of 4.3 million tons of CO₂ in 2023, equivalent to the cultivation of 30 million trees over 20 years.

Usina Colorado and CEM adopt best practices in the management and use of by-products from the sugarcane industrial process, such as straw, filter cake, and vinasse. These materials undergo systematic control and monitoring to ensure efficient utilisation and environmentally appropriate disposal, promoting the conservation of soil and water.
Vinasse
The vinasse resulting from ethanol production is rich in potassium. For this reason, it is an important fertiliser with the ability to restore soil fertility. The Colorado Group applies vinasse to its sugarcane plantation areas, contributing to increased productivity, greater longevity of sugarcane fields, and improved chemical characteristics of the soil.
Filter Cake
Filter cake is a by-product of sugar, ethanol, and electricity production. It serves as an alternative source of nutrients for sugarcane fields, enabling a reduction in the use of chemical fertilisers.
We Take Good Care of Water
Usina Colorado and CEM consume less than one cubic metre of water per tonne of sugarcane milled. This exceptional result is due to a closed-loop water recirculation system, which allows for a high rate of water reuse in the industrial process. The mills have implemented actions to protect and restore riparian areas and to conserve soil, aiming to safeguard water resources. They measure the volume of water captured and ensure its efficient use. Both companies also carry out environmentally appropriate treatment and disposal of water.
We Preserve the Soil
Usina Colorado and CEM adopt best practices in soil preparation, as well as actions to prevent and control erosion and ensure proper management to mitigate soil compaction. They conduct monitoring of erosive processes and areas with potential for erosion within cultivation zones. The mills also implement best practices to avoid soil compaction, such as traffic control, compliance with optimal conditions for planting and harvesting, livestock trampling control, and the use of precision agriculture techniques.
We Minimise Waste Generation
The Colorado Group carries out efficient solid waste management, ensuring the proper disposal, segregation, destination, and final placement of waste materials, in accordance with their characteristics and in an environmentally responsible manner. Reuse, recycling, recovery, and co-processing are among the methods adopted. Through training initiatives, the Colorado Group raises awareness and educates its employees about the proper disposal of waste. In partnership with specialised companies, the Group promotes employee training on waste storage and transport, segregation of Class I and Class II waste, and appropriate disposal of cardboard, plastic, and wooden packaging that are free of contamination. Clean and uncontaminated materials are commercialised for reuse in other production cycles.
Respect for the Environment
In addition to producing low-carbon biofuel and bioenergy, the Colorado Group’s mills are committed to the conservation and preservation of environmental areas. They promote the planting and maintenance of native seedlings to enrich native forest fragments and restore riparian forests, thereby helping to protect flora, fauna, and water resources. Usina Colorado maintains the Fazenda São Sebastião Seedling Nursery, established in 2003.
Often used for environmental education initiatives involving schools, students, and the local community, the nursery has produced thousands of tree specimens, cultivating over one hundred species of native regional flora, as well as exotic species used for urban greening and landscaping. Recovered areas are monitored through monthly inspections over several years.
This initiative ensures the favourable conditions for the successional stages of the restoration area, allowing the native seedlings to reach full development and contribute to the formation of a new forest ecosystem.
We Respect the Biomes
Usina Colorado
Guaíra is located within the Cerrado Biome, the second largest biome in Brazil, covering approximately 24% of the national territory.
Central Energética Morrinhos
The territory of the municipality of Morrinhos is composed of 96% Cerrado Biome and 4% Atlantic Forest Biome.
